Changeset 16730 for branches


Ignore:
Timestamp:
2007/11/06 22:41:13 (15 years ago)
Author:
naka
Message:

ブロック編集パス変更

Location:
branches/feature-module-update/data/class/pages
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/feature-module-update/data/class/pages/admin/design/LC_Page_Admin_Design_Bloc.php

    r16676 r16730  
    6161        $objView = new SC_AdminView(); 
    6262        $this->objLayout = new SC_Helper_PageLayout_Ex(); 
    63  
     63        $package_path = USER_TEMPLATE_PATH . "/" . TEMPLATE_NAME . "/"; 
     64         
    6465        // 認証可否の判定 
    6566        $objSess = new SC_Session(); 
     
    8485 
    8586            // ユーザー作成ブロックが存在する場合 
    86             if (is_file(USER_PATH . $arrBlocData[0]['tpl_path'])) { 
    87                 $arrBlocData[0]['tpl_path'] = USER_PATH 
    88                     . $arrBlocData[0]['tpl_path']; 
     87            if (is_file($package_path . $arrBlocData[0]['tpl_path'])) { 
     88                $arrBlocData[0]['tpl_path'] = $package_path . $arrBlocData[0]['tpl_path']; 
    8989 
    9090            // 存在しない場合は指定テンプレートのブロックを取得 
    9191            } else { 
    92                 $arrBlocData[0]['tpl_path'] = TEMPLATE_DIR 
    93                     . $arrBlocData[0]['tpl_path']; 
     92                $arrBlocData[0]['tpl_path'] = TEMPLATE_DIR . $arrBlocData[0]['tpl_path']; 
    9493            } 
    95  
     94             
    9695            // テンプレートファイルの読み込み 
    9796            $arrBlocData[0]['tpl_data'] = file_get_contents($arrBlocData[0]['tpl_path']); 
     
    136135 
    137136                // 旧ファイルの削除 
    138                 $old_bloc_path = USER_PATH . $arrBlocData[0]['tpl_path']; 
     137                $old_bloc_path = $package_path . $arrBlocData[0]['tpl_path']; 
    139138                if (file_exists($old_bloc_path)) { 
    140139                    unlink($old_bloc_path); 
     
    142141                 
    143142                // ファイル作成 
    144                 $new_bloc_path = USER_PATH . BLOC_DIR . $_POST['filename'] . ".tpl"; 
     143                $new_bloc_path = $package_path . BLOC_DIR . $_POST['filename'] . ".tpl"; 
    145144                // ディレクトリの作成             
    146145                SC_Utils::sfMakeDir($new_bloc_path); 
     
    184183 
    185184                // ファイルの削除 
    186                 $del_file = BLOC_PATH . $arrBlocData[0]['filename']. '.tpl'; 
     185                $del_file = $package_path . BLOC_DIR . $arrBlocData[0]['filename']. '.tpl'; 
    187186                if(file_exists($del_file)){ 
    188187                    unlink($del_file); 
  • branches/feature-module-update/data/class/pages/frontparts/bloc/LC_Page_FrontParts_Bloc.php

    r16677 r16730  
    4141    function setTplMainpage($bloc_file) { 
    4242        $debug_message = ""; 
    43         $user_bloc_path = USER_PATH . BLOC_DIR . $bloc_file; 
     43        $user_bloc_path = USER_TEMPLATE_PATH . "/" . TEMPLATE_NAME . "/" . BLOC_DIR . $bloc_file; 
    4444        if (is_file($user_bloc_path)) { 
    4545            $this->tpl_mainpage = $user_bloc_path; 
Note: See TracChangeset for help on using the changeset viewer.